Suchergebnisse für Anfrage "list-comprehension"

6 die antwort

Nested For Loops Using List Comprehension

Wenn ich zwei Saiten hatte,'abc' und'def', Ich könnte alle Kombinationen von ihnen mit zwei for-Schleifen erhalten: for j in s1: for k in s2: print(j, k) Ich möchte dies jedoch mit Hilfe des Listenverständnisses tun können. Ich habe viele ...

4 die antwort

Was sind Swifts Gegenstücke zu Array.some () und Array.every () von JavaScript?

Swift bietetmap, filter, reduce, ... zumArray 's, aber ich finde nichtsome (oderany) oderevery (oderall) deren Gegenstücke in JavaScript @ siArray.some [https://developer.mozilla.org/en-US/docs/Web/JavaScript/Reference/Global_Objects/Array/some] ...

6 die antwort

Summe der Elemente in der Python-Liste nur, wenn die Elemente in einer separaten Booleschen Liste True sind

Ich habe zwei Python-Listen, A = [ 1, 2, 3, 4, 5 ] B = [ True, False, False, True, True ]listen A und B sind gleich lang. Ich möchte nur die Elemente in A zusammenfassen, die den wahren Elementen in B entsprechen. Ich weiß, dass ich das mit ...

TOP-Veröffentlichungen

2 die antwort

List vs Generator Verständnis Geschwindigkeit mit Join-Funktion [duplizieren]

Diese Frage hat hier bereits eine Antwort: Listenverständnis gegen die seltsamen Timeit-Ergebnisse des Generatorausdrucks? [/questions/11964130/list-comprehension-vs-generator-expressions-weird-timeit-results] 3 answersListenverständnis ohne [] ...

8 die antwort

Erweiterte Syntax für das Verständnis verschachtelter Listen

Ich habe mit Listenverständnissen herumgespielt, um sie besser zu verstehen, und bin auf eine unerwartete Ausgabe gestoßen, die ich nicht erklären kann. Ich habe diese Frage vorher noch nicht gestellt bekommen, aber wenn es sich um ...

2 die antwort

Schneller Weg, einen Iterator in eine Liste zu konvertieren

Hat einiterator Objekt, gibt es etwas schnelleres, besseres oder korrekteres als ein Listenverständnis, um eine Liste der vom Iterator zurückgegebenen Objekte zu erhalten? user_list = [user for user in user_iterator]

4 die antwort

Wie wird das Listenverständnis mit der .extend-Listenmethode verwendet? [Duplikat

Diese Frage hat hier bereits eine Antwort: Wie kann ich ein Listenverständnis verwenden, um eine Liste in Python zu erweitern? [Duplikat [/questions/5947137/how-can-i-use-a-list-comprehension-to-extend-a-list-in-python] 6 answers Zum Beispiel ...

6 die antwort

Optimale Methode zum Ermitteln der maximalen Anzahl von Unterlistenelementen in der Liste

Ich habe eine mehrdimensionale Liste im Format: list = [[1, 2, 3], [2, 4, 2], [0, 1, 1]]Wie erhalte ich den Maximalwert des dritten Wertes aller Unterlisten? Im Pseudocode: max(list[0][2], list[1][2], list[2][2])Ich weiß, dass dies getan werden ...

12 die antwort

list.extend und Listenverständnis

Wenn ich der Liste mehrere identische Elemente hinzufügen muss, verwende ich list.extend: a = ['a', 'b', 'c'] a.extend(['d']*3)Ergebni ['a', 'b', 'c', 'd', 'd', 'd']Aber, wie mache ich das ähnlich mit Listenverständnis? a = [['a',2], ['b',2], ...

4 die antwort

* = Python-Operator kann beim Listenverständnis nicht verwendet werden [duplizieren]

Diese Frage hat hier bereits eine Antwort: Wie kann ich Aufgaben in einem Listenverständnis ausführen? [/questions/10291997/how-can-i-do-assignments-in-a-list-comprehension] 5 Antworten Ich bin nicht sicher, warum ich das @ nicht verwenden ka*= ...